		<description><![CDATA[The area surrounding Calais has long been the home of the Passamaquoddy tribe and possibly their predecessors the Red Paint people.  Legend has it that the region my have been visited by Leif Erickson and other Viking explorers.  Later explorers possibly included John Cabot, Verrazano, and various Portuguese explorers.

		<description><![CDATA[Every Tuesday evening in July and August, you can be sure to find something to do in Calais.  Music on the Green, sponsored by local merchants, is a weekly event to showcase local musical talent, and allow residents of Calais (and even residents of St. Stephen, NB!) to get together and have fun.
